About this property

Spring skiing at Sunday River!

The Amos Coggin River House is set in the woods along the banks of the Androscoggin River, a place that inspires both relaxation AND adventure with each passing season. . .
Located in a premier river front location within the community of Jordan Woods, the Amos Coggin River House offers miles of scenic trails right from our door via the IT system and Mahoosuc Land Trust. This affords our guests the opportunity to explore the woods and riverside by foot or bike in the warmer months or by snowmobile, xc skis, snowshoes OR fat tire bikes all winter long! We are less than 15 minutes from world class skiing at Sunday River, and within ten minutes to Bethel's 'Norman Rockwell - like' Main Street for fine dining, unique shops, and seasonal shows and fairs. You will also find grocery and hardware stores, banks, a small movie theater and brand new bowling alley and bar.
We are set on the banks of the river, so a trip here would not be complete without a paddle down the Androscoggin via kayak or canoe in the spring and summer months. Shuttle service is available for a small fee through the Bethel Adventure Center for 2 hour to all day excursions. . We can also provide information for setting up an L.L. Bean adventure package to learn about water sports and archery at our location.
The fall season is absolute paradise as there is no prettier place for leaf peeping with many charted drives in and around Bethel and the western mountains of Maine up through to Rangeley. The Oxford Casino is under an hour away for nightlife and entertainment, and North Conway , NH, is also under an hour for the best of outlet shopping and some foliage touring along the way.
